With more than 30 years experience and over 130 employees throughout the UK and Ireland, Mulmar is a leader in the supply and maintenance of some of the world s finest espresso coffee machines in offices, high street coffee shops, restaurants, airports, hotels and food retailers.

We are now recruiting for a Workshop Engineer to assume responsibility for the refurbishment of commercial coffee machines to working standard and undertaking planned maintenance schedules.

About the Workshop Engineer role:

Our Workshop Engineer will be responsible for the refurbishment of coffee machines to working standard and undertaking planned maintenance schedules.

In addition to this you will be responsible for:

  • Refurbishment of customer machines including diagnostic analysis of operational faults, upgrade components as required.
  • Running and cleaning powering up machines, operate under customer conditions, adjust drinks parameters to customer specification, ensure that machine is both operationally and cosmetically fit for purpose.
  • Ordering parts, replacement units as required.
  • Liaising with manager / customer services re machine status / availability.
  • Undertaking other tasks as required in accordance with competence and ability.

It is essential that you have:

  • Basic understanding of electricity and ability to understand equipment drawings / diagrams.
  • Experience of maintaining electro-mechanical equipment or as an electrician.
  • Electrical, hydraulic and mechanical fault diagnostic skills.
  • Competent using of electrical testing equipment.
  • Good communication skills

It would be great if you have:

  • Previous experience as a workshop engineer
